How Property Management Companies Handle Rent & Maintenance Together

Managing a rental property is more than just collecting rent—it involves continuous coordination, maintenance, tenant handling, and legal compliance. For many landlords, especially NRIs or busy professionals, managing everything alone becomes difficult. This is where property management companies step in.

Modern property management firms streamline both rent collection and property maintenance using professional systems, skilled teams, and technology-driven processes.
Here’s how they handle both aspects seamlessly.

1. A Centralized System for Rent & Maintenance Management

Property management companies integrate both functions into a single workflow.
This includes:

  • Digital rent collection

  • Automated reminders

  • Maintenance tracking

  • Monthly statements

  • Expense records

A unified system reduces errors and improves transparency for landlords.

2. Efficient Rent Collection & Follow-Up

Property management companies ensure rent collection happens smoothly through:

  • Online payments (UPI, bank transfer, apps)

  • Automated payment reminders

  • Late fee enforcement

  • Tenant follow-up for delays

  • Monthly rent reports for owners

This ensures consistent cash flow without landlord intervention.

3. Quick Response to Maintenance Issues

Maintenance is one of the biggest challenges for landlords. Property managers handle:

  • Regular inspections

  • Plumbing, electrical, carpentry repairs

  • Appliance servicing

  • Painting and cleaning

  • Emergency repairs

They coordinate with trusted vendors to fix issues quickly and at fair prices.

4. Preventive Maintenance to Avoid Bigger Costs

Instead of waiting for breakdowns, companies schedule periodic checks for:

  • Leakage and seepage

  • Electrical wiring

  • HVAC servicing

  • Pest control

  • Structural checks

Preventive care saves money and increases the life of the property.

5. Transparent Tracking for Both Rent & Maintenance

Many firms provide dashboards or monthly reports that include:

  • Rent collected

  • Pending payments

  • Maintenance requests

  • Bills & invoices

  • Before/after photos of repairs

  • Staying tenant details

Landlords have complete visibility, even from abroad.

6. Tenant Coordination for Smooth Operations

Property managers handle all tenant interactions:

  • Receiving maintenance complaints

  • Scheduling repairs

  • Informing tenants about rent rules

  • Handling disputes

  • Coordinating move-in/move-out

  • Explaining maintenance responsibilities

This keeps relationships professional and stress-free.

7. Budgeting & Cost Control

Property management companies help landlords manage expenses efficiently by:

  • Creating annual maintenance budgets

  • Avoiding overpriced repairs

  • Negotiating with vendors

  • Reducing wastage

This ensures better returns on investment.

8. Ensuring Legal Compliance

Property managers ensure:

  • Correct rental agreement clauses

  • Maintenance responsibilities as per law

  • Proper rent receipts

  • Tenant verification compliance

  • Safety standard checks

Legal clarity reduces the chances of disputes.

9. Emergency Support 24/7

Many companies offer round-the-clock support for urgent issues like:

  • Water leakage

  • Electrical failures

  • Lockouts

  • Security problems

Such services are crucial, especially when landlords live elsewhere.

10. Enhancing Tenant Satisfaction

By promptly handling rent, repairs, and property issues, property managers improve:

  • Tenant satisfaction

  • Tenant stay duration

  • Reputation of the property

  • Rent renewal rates

Happy tenants mean stable rental income.
